When can I expect good weather in Yuxi?
Planning for the weather is an important factor for making your trip to Yuxi a success, especially when you're splurging. The hottest months are usually May and June with an average temp of 68°F, while the coldest months are January and December with an average of 52°F. The rainiest months in Yuxi are August, July, June, and September, with each month seeing an average of 8 inches of rainfall.
What's there to see and do in Yuxi?
Enjoy Yuxi with a stop at Luchong Scenic Resort, Fuxian Lake, and Mt. Xiushan Scenic Resort. If you have a bit of extra time while you're in the area, you might want to check out Hani Terrace and Gaogu Pavilion.
